Platforms for advertising are essential for businesses to reach their target audience and promote their products or services. In today’s digital age, there are numerous platforms available for advertising, each with its own unique features and advantages.
One popular platform for advertising is social media. With billions of active users, plat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and LinkedIn offer businesses the opportunity to reach a wide and diverse audience. According to Statista, as of early 2021, Facebook had over 2.8 billion monthly active users, making it a powerful platform for advertising. Additionally, social media platforms provide advanced targeting options, allowing businesses to reach specific demographics, interests, and behavior patterns.
Another effective platform for advertising is search engines. Google, the most popular search engine, offers businesses the chance to display their ads at the top of search results through Google Ads. This enables businesses to appear in front of users who are actively searching for products or services similar to what they offer. In fact, according to WordStream, businesses make an average of $2 in revenue for every $1 they spend on Google Ads, highlighting the effectiveness of this platform.
In recent years, streaming platforms have gained significant popularity, providing businesses with new advertising opportunities. Platforms like YouTube and Twitch allow businesses to display ads before or during videos or livestreams, reaching a large and engaged audience. According to YouTube, over 2 billion logged-in users visit the platform each month, providing businesses with substantial reach and potential. Furthermore, with the rise of influencer marketing, businesses can collaborate with popular content creators to promote their products or services to their followers on these platforms, further boosting brand awareness.
Mobile advertising has also become a crucial platform for businesses to reach their target audience. With the widespread usage of smartphones, mobile ads are an effective way to reach users on the go. In fact, according to eMarketer, mobile advertising accounted for around 51% of global digital ad spending in 2020, surpassing desktop advertising. Mobile advertising can take various forms, including in-app ads, mobile banners, or push notifications, allowing businesses to reach users directly on their devices.
Programmatic advertising is another important platform for businesses to consider. It utilizes artificial intelligence and real-time bidding to automate the buying and selling of advertising space. This technology enables businesses to target specific audiences and optimize their campaigns in real-time, increasing the effectiveness of their advertising efforts. According to eMarketer, programmatic advertising accounted for over 85% of digital display ad spending in the United States in 2020, highlighting its growing significance in the advertising landscape.

FAQ: Different Platforms for Advertising
1. What are the different platforms for online advertising?
The various platforms for online advertising include search engines, social media platforms, email marketing, display advertising networks, and video sharing sites.
2. How does advertising on search engines work?
Advertising on search engines involves bidding for keywords relevant to your business. When someone searches for those keywords, your ad appears at the top of the search results, increasing your visibility.
3. Can you explain advertising on social media platforms?
Social media platforms offer advertising options where businesses can create targeted ad campaigns to reach specific demographics or interests of users on these platforms. Ads can appear in users’ feeds or as sponsored content.
4. What are the benefits of email marketing for advertising?
Email marketing allows businesses to directly reach their target audience, build customer loyalty, and personalize their messaging. It is a cost-effective way to promote products or services and drive conversions.
5. How do display advertising networks work?
Display advertising networks connect advertisers with website owners who allocate a portion of their site real estate for ads. Advertisers bid on ad placements, and their ads are displayed on relevant websites within the network.
6. Can you explain advertising on video sharing sites?
Advertising on video sharing sites involves displaying ads before, during, or after videos. Businesses can target specific video categories or demographics to reach their desired audience.
7. Are there any advantages to advertising on search engines?
Advertising on search engines allows businesses to target users actively searching for products or services similar to what they offer. It ensures high visibility and immediate access to potential customers.
8. Why should businesses consider advertising on social media platforms?
Advertising on social media platforms enables businesses to leverage user data to create highly targeted ad campaigns. It provides an opportunity to reach a vast user base and engage with potential customers through interactive content.
9. What are the benefits of email marketing as an advertising strategy?
Email marketing allows businesses to nurture relationships with existing customers, share exclusive offers, and keep customers informed about updates or new products. It helps drive repeat sales and generates customer feedback.
10. How can businesses measure the success of display advertising?
Businesses can track the performance of display advertising by monitoring metrics like click-through rates, conversion rates, impressions, and the return on investment (ROI) generated from the ad campaigns.
11. What are the key advantages of advertising on video sharing sites?
Advertising on video sharing sites provides businesses with the opportunity to engage with users through captivating video content. It offers a wide reach, as video consumption continues to rise, and allows for enhanced storytelling and brand awareness.
12. Is it necessary to advertise on all online platforms?
No, it is not necessary to advertise on all online platforms. Businesses should consider their target audience and their goals to determine which platforms will yield the best results and align with their marketing budget.
13. Can businesses advertise on multiple platforms simultaneously?
Yes, businesses can advertise on multiple platforms simultaneously. In fact, leveraging multiple platforms can enhance visibility, reach different audience segments, and increase the chances of reaching potential customers at different touchpoints along their online journey.
